The family requests memorials be made to the American Heart Association or the charity of your choice. Mr. Dunn was born in Henderson, NC. He began his Naval career in 1944. During his 30 years in the Navy, he was stationed on-board the USS California, the USS Chloris, the USS Yorktown and the USS Constellation. He served in WWII, the Korean War, Vietnam, and the Invasion of the Philippians, as well a being a part of the Mississippi Search while stationed at NAS in 1964. After retiring from the Navy in 1975, Mr. Dunn went back to college to receive a degree from Meridian Jr. College, beginning a new career with the MS Employment Service as Veteran's Representative until he retired in 1988. "Choo- Choo" was a Mason for approximately 45 years and a member of the Long Street Lodge, Scottish Rite, York Rite, and Hamasa Shrine. His biggest joy during his retirement has been his longtime coffee clubs, being a member of the 9:30 Coffee Club at Jeans Restaurant, the News Restaurant, the Checker Board Coffee Club, and the many other convenience store coffee clubs he joined with his friends each day.
